With that motor and even a 100 shot you should go 10s. Not on your first pass maybe but you should be able to dial it in to the tens with some work. I wouldn't hit it with a 200 shot. Personally, I would go for the stroke because you can build it for about the same price if you're going all new parts so why not throw in the extra cubes. If you're planning on nitrous though I'd go with a shorter stroke than the 3.4 and maybe settle on the 3.25 stroke. That way you get a little tougher piston/ ring config and will be better for longevity for the nitrous.
